The conversion rate between pennies and dollars is straightforward. One dollar is equal to 100 cents, and one penny is equal to 1/100 of a dollar. To determine the value of 800,000 pennies in dollars, we can simply divide the number of pennies by 100.

800,000 pennies / 100 = 8,000 dollars

Therefore, 800,000 pennies are equivalent to 8,000 dollars. This conversion is based on the face value of the pennies, assuming that they are all in good condition and have not been altered or melted down.
